Tourism New Zealand has started to utilise Weibo, China's version of Twitter, to attract Chinese tourists to visit the country.
Tourism NZ has appointed Yao Chen, China's most followed microblogger, as its brand ambassador in the Mainland. Yao caught the attention of more than 10.9 million followers on Sina Weibo.
Yao went on a promotional trip to New Zealand under the marketing campaign ‘100 Hours: Chen Yao Revives Your Emotions'. Yao showed her followers New Zealand's sights through attached photos in her entries.
Tourism NZ General Manager Asia Markets, Mark Frood, was quoted in eTurbo News as having said that they believe that Yao's influence will help raise Chinese tourists' interest in their country and encourage them to experience New Zealand first-hand.
